feat(check): add Layer 1 local backend probe before SSH auth
check_connectivity now runs a two-layer short-circuit probe:
Layer 1: TCP connect to (local_host, local_port) to confirm the
backend service (e.g. Gitea, Next.js) is actually listening.
Layer 2: original SSH auth probe (unchanged).
This fixes the common false-positive where check returned OK while the
tunneled backend was down. Unlike the previously removed _is_port_in_use
bind check (commit 4c9cd00), this uses connect() with correct semantics:
the forward target SHOULD be listening, not free.
